Study Notes
- Before 1959, Cuba was heavily influenced by the United States economically and politically.
- The US had significant investments in Cuban industries, particularly in sugar plantations, and maintained strong economic ties with the country.
- Cuba was ruled by Fulgencio Batista, a military director.
- Batista had US support due to his anti-communist stance.
- Batista's regime was marked by corruption, repression, and increasing social inequity, which led to growing unrest among Cuban people.
- Fidel Castro led revolution against Batista in the Guerrilla wars of 1950, leading the 26th of July Movement.
- By 1959, Castro overthrew Batista, bringing tensions with the USA.
- Cuba was a major American ally; the USA owned most businesses on the island.
- Cuban General Batista was corrupt and an unpopular dictator.
- The US provided economic and military support and also opposed communism.
- By 1959, there was plenty of opposition to Batista in Cuba
- After 3 years of campaigning, Fidel Castro overthrew him.
- Castro was charming, clever, and ruthless, and killed or exiled many political opponents.
